Automatic bottle label applicator selection for UK production lines: what to check before choosing a labeller.

Automatic bottle label applicators are chosen when the labelling process needs repeatable placement, controlled throughput and integration with wider filling or packing equipment.

The correct route is normally decided by bottle shape, label position, label roll details, target output and the way the machine will connect with filling, capping, coding or conveyor equipment.

For a more accurate recommendation, send photos or samples of the container together with label dimensions, roll direction, material, backing paper and the number of labels needed per product.

Specification points

  • Review the bottle shape, label position and speed before choosing an automatic route.
  • Decide whether the machine needs one label head, twin heads or additional coding and inspection.
  • Confirm conveyor height, infeed space, accumulation and operator access early.
  • Send samples to check stability, label material and detection before final specification.

Buyer questions

Questions before choosing a bottle labeller.

What determines the right machine type?

Bottle shape, label position, speed, operator involvement and line integration determine the best route.

Can the machine be specified from photos?

Photos help narrow the route, but physical samples and label details are recommended before final specification.
